How much do vp content strategy jobs pay per year?

As of May 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for vp content strategy in the United States is $141,955.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$100,000.00 and $194,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a VP of Content Strategy do?

A VP of Content Strategy leads the development and execution of content initiatives to align with business goals, enhance brand visibility, and engage target audiences. They oversee content creation, distribution, and performance analytics, ensuring consistency across platforms. This role involves collaborating with marketing, product, and sales teams to optimize messaging and storytelling. Additionally, they analyze market trends and audience insights to refine content strategies and drive grow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Vp Content Strategy position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a VP Content Strategy, you need extensive experience in content development, editorial leadership, and strategic planning—often supported by a degree in communications,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with content management systems (CMS), data analytics tools, SEO platforms, and content performance metrics is typically required. Excellent leadership, communication, and cross-functional collaboration abilities are essential soft skills for driving team success and stakeholder alignment. These skills enable the VP to effectively shape content strategies that align with business objectives and produce measurable results.

What are the primary challenges a VP Content Strategy may face in this role?

A VP Content Strategy often faces challenges such as balancing creative vision with business objectives, managing diverse teams across multiple platforms, and continuously adapting to rapidly changing digital trends. Additionally, aligning the content strategy with evolving target audience behaviors and ensuring consistent messaging across channels can be complex. Success in this role often requires proactive communication, strong analytical skills, and the ability to lead teams through change. Many organizations value VPs who can foster innovation while maintaining high standards for quality and effectiveness in content delivery.

Vice President, Content and Events - Energy & Industrials
GLG's Content and Events team delivers best-in-class virtual and in-person programming by engaging industry leaders in conversations about the market movements and trends reshaping industries today. Our events provide timely, actionable insights to top investment professionals and business leaders around the world.
We are seeking a strategic and intellectually curious Vice President, Content to lead programming efforts centered around the Energy and Industrials sectors. This role is ideal for someone passionate about these dynamic industries and experienced in developing high-impact content and events for sophisticated audiences. The VP will be responsible for shaping the editorial strategy, guiding a high-performing team, and delivering compelling programming tailored to the needs of global investment funds.
Key Responsibilities:
• Lead the development and execution of virtual and in-person events focused on Energy and Industrials, including expert interviews, panels, and thematic series.
• Define and drive content strategy aligned with the priorities of leading financial services clients.
• Identify and engage senior industry executives and thought leaders to participate in programming.
• Collaborate with internal stakeholders to ensure content aligns with client interests and market trends.
• Mentor and manage a team of content professionals, fostering a culture of excellence, curiosity, and collaboration.
• Monitor industry developments to proactively surface timely and relevant topics.
• Ensure high standards of quality, consistency, and client engagement across all programming.
Qualifications:
• Bachelor's degree required; advanced degree in a relevant field (e.g., Business, Journalism, Economics) preferred.
• 7+ years of experience in content development, research, journalism, or programming, ideally within the financial services, consulting, or energy/industrials sectors.
• Demonstrated ability to lead, mentor, and develop both younger and seasoned professionals.
•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with experience engaging senior stakeholders.
• Extensive knowledge of the energy and Industrials sectors and links to market dynamics.
